    Understanding Angola Overflight Requirements

    When is an Overflight Permit Required?

    All aircraft crossing Angola airspace must obtain prior authorization unless exempt under:

    • Bilateral air service agreements
    • Diplomatic/military flights (with prior coordination)
    • Certain UN/Red Cross humanitarian missions

    Key ANACIS Regulations to Know

    • Applications must be submitted at least 72 hours before operation
    • Complete flight details including waypoint coordinates required
    • Fees based on aircraft MTOW and route distance
    • All documents must be in French (we provide translation services)

    Common Reasons for Permit Delays

    Avoid these frequent issues that cause 90% of delays:
    ❌ Incomplete aircraft documentation
    ❌ Documents not properly translated to French
    ❌ Incorrect route coordinates
    ❌ Insufficient application lead time
    ❌ Weekend/holiday submissions
    ❌ Payment processing delays

    The Cost of Non-Compliance

    Failure to secure proper authorization may result in:

    • Substantial fines ($5,000-$20,000)
    • Operational disruptions and delays
    • Future permit complications
    • Reputational damage with ANACIS
